I was looking for a vertical sleeve, no zipper, slim but sturdy enough to bounce around in my backpack with heavy books, powerbars, and the occasional petrified gummy bear. Here are my top choices:
Incipio http://www.myincipio.com/MacBook-Air-Cases-Accessories/MacBook-Air-Cases-Accessories.asp- Orion or leather sleeve (looked nice but out of stock in most colors. Some reviews said that these were too small for the Air 13". Gap at the top didn't look like it offered a lot of protection)
BauBau neoprene skin http://www.shoebuy.com/baubau-macair-slip-sleeve-13/322215/690076?cm_mmc=dealtime-_-none-_-none-_-none(simple and minimal, but some posts suggested that neoprene alone would not offer enough protection for my planned use. Also, I didn't love the look of it)
Incase neoprene sleeve http://www.goincase.com/products/detail/neoprene-sleeve-cl57802/3 - Just about perfect, but again the issue w/ neoprene alone.
COTEetCIEL http://www.coteetciel.com/store/sleeves/macbook-air.html - beautiful case. Just about perfect but only a horizontal opening (no vertical). Plus, I was a little worried about shipping from Europe.
JoliOriginals http://www.etsy.com/shop/JoliOriginals/sold - Gorgeous sleeve but very expensive (from what I hear). Prices are not posted since the store is closed at the moment.
Radtech http://www.radtech.us/products/SleevzNotebooks.aspx - nice looking but didn't seem to offer a great deal of protection.
Crumpler "Fug" http://www.crumpler.com/us/Laptop-Bags/Laptop-Carrying-Cases/Fug-13.html?LanguageCode=EN&SKU=FU0401A - great looking case but again the issue of protection.
Finally I chose the WaterField sleeve case http://www.sfbags.com/products/sleevecases/sleevecases.php. It's fully customizable, fairly heavy duty but still small and light. I ordered the vertical version w/ no flap and the leather bottom. I placed the order about an hour ago and have already received 2 confirmation emails telling me that it will ship today.
